Summary
Patients undergoing carotid revascularization procedures are at increased risk for the
 development of short- and long-term cardiac complications. Increased values of high-sensitive
 troponin may be useful in a timely selection of those patients. Still, contemporary
 literature doesn't provide enough data to answer the following questions: Can high-sensitive
 troponin predict adverse cardiac outcomes perioperatively in carotid surgery?, Should these
 cardiac biomarkers be routinely sampled in all patients undergoing carotid
 revascularization? and Can elevated levels of high-sensitive troponin preoperatively
 designate patients in whom the risk of surgical treatment (at a given moment) is greater than
 the benefit of the surgery?.
